WebApr 11, 2024 · About Wheat Crop. Wheat, an important rabi (winter) crop, is seeded from late October to December; it reaches maturity in mid-March, and harvesting of early-sown types normally begins by the end of March. Temperature: 10-15°C (sowing period) to 21-26°C (ripening and harvesting) with bright sunshine. Soil Type: Well-drained fertile loamy and ...
